As of today, some of the sanctions imposed on Iran terminate, Ali Bagheri Kani, Political Deputy at the Ministry of Foreign Affairs of Iran said on his X account, APA reports.
According to Kani, as of 18 October 2023, in accordance with United Nations Security Council Resolutions 2231 (UNSCR), all restrictions imposed on ballistic missile-related activities and transfers to/from the Islamic Republic of Iran terminate: "Iran is no longer subject to any restriction in the context of the Security Council. As of today, all restrictions imposed on the individuals & entities on 2231 list, inc. freezing of assets, terminate and the list will be removed from the UN website.
All national or regional restrictive measures/sanctions imposed against Iran on the basis of UNSCR 2231 shall be terminated accordingly. Maintaining such measures or imposing new ones clearly violate letter and spirit of UNSCR 2231."
